Reel Talk: Creed




by DaCognegro


Synopsis: Adonis Johnson never knew his famous father, boxing champion Apollo Creed. However, boxing is in his blood, so he seeks out Rocky Balboa to seek his guidance and direction.

Review: It has always been the authentic connection with the underdog, as he overcame insurmountable odds, that has made some of the more successful  entries in the Rocky franchise enjoyable and crowd pleasing. But, perhaps it was high expectations due to the talent involved , the release of the superior Southpaw earlier this year, or the fact that the contrived dialogue, hasty pacing and characterization, cartoonish cinematography during the fight scenes,  and failure to evoke true ethos,  that makes Creed a pretender as oppose to a real contender to carry the Rocky brand! Hit the showers kid! (C)  CgN
